ML350 G5 VRM/PPM confusion

Hi all. I'm replacing the single proc in one of my clients ML350 G5 with two processors. I realize I'll need a VRM/PPM. In a previous thread I saw part 413980-001 which appears as a "Power Module : Processor power module (PPM)"
On partsurfer. But it appears to be more costly than a similar item. In my search what I did find is a bunch of G5 ML350 cpu kits which include the following.
407748-001 PC Board : Processor power board (PPM)

Are these two the same thing?? I mean the partsurfer description calls them both PPM??

Re: ML350 G5 VRM/PPM confusion

FYI. 407748-001 Does in fact work. You do not need to buy 413980-001 or any other part number as a PPM for a ML350 G5. This part number works fine, we bought one and successfully installed it during a cpu upgrade.
